typedefs_neg.cc: Tweak line numbers.

2007-07-02  Douglas Gregor  <doug.gregor@gmail.com>

        * testsuite/20_util/make_signed/requirements/typedefs_neg.cc:
        Tweak line numbers.
        * testsuite/20_util/make_unsigned/requirements/typedefs_neg.cc:
        Ditto.
        * testsuite/20_util/make_unsigned/requirements/typedefs-1.cc:
        Don't try to create an unsigned wchar_t.
        * testsuite/20_util/make_unsigned/requirements/typedefs-2.cc:
        Don't try to create an unsigned wchar_t.
        * testsuite/util/testsuite_hooks.h: Remove a stray semicolon.

From-SVN: r126203
This commit is contained in:
Douglas Gregor 2007-07-02 13:11:13 +00:00 committed by Doug Gregor
parent 76dc15d453
commit 269ef14dfd
6 changed files with 19 additions and 7 deletions

View file

@ -1,3 +1,15 @@
2007-07-02 Douglas Gregor <doug.gregor@gmail.com>
* testsuite/20_util/make_signed/requirements/typedefs_neg.cc:
Tweak line numbers.
* testsuite/20_util/make_unsigned/requirements/typedefs_neg.cc:
Ditto.
* testsuite/20_util/make_unsigned/requirements/typedefs-1.cc:
Don't try to create an unsigned wchar_t.
* testsuite/20_util/make_unsigned/requirements/typedefs-2.cc:
Don't try to create an unsigned wchar_t.
* testsuite/util/testsuite_hooks.h: Remove a stray semicolon.
2007-07-01 Douglas Gregor <doug.gregor@gmail.com>
* include/std/type_traits (__make_unsigned): Remove invalid

View file

@ -49,8 +49,8 @@ void test01()
// { dg-error "instantiated from here" "" { target *-*-* } 41 }
// { dg-error "instantiated from here" "" { target *-*-* } 43 }
// { dg-error "invalid use of incomplete type" "" { target *-*-* } 497 }
// { dg-error "declaration of" "" { target *-*-* } 463 }
// { dg-error "invalid use of incomplete type" "" { target *-*-* } 489 }
// { dg-error "declaration of" "" { target *-*-* } 455 }
// { dg-excess-errors "At global scope" }
// { dg-excess-errors "In instantiation of" }

View file

@ -49,7 +49,7 @@ void test01()
#ifdef _GLIBCXX_USE_WCHAR_T
typedef make_unsigned<volatile wchar_t>::type test23_type;
VERIFY( (is_same<test23_type, volatile unsigned wchar_t>::value) );
VERIFY( (is_same<test23_type, volatile wchar_t>::value) );
#endif
typedef make_unsigned<test_enum>::type test25_type;

View file

@ -49,7 +49,7 @@ void test01()
#ifdef _GLIBCXX_USE_WCHAR_T
typedef make_unsigned<volatile wchar_t>::type test23_type;
VERIFY( (is_same<test23_type, volatile unsigned wchar_t>::value) );
VERIFY( (is_same<test23_type, volatile wchar_t>::value) );
#endif
typedef make_unsigned<test_enum>::type test25_type;

View file

@ -49,8 +49,8 @@ void test01()
// { dg-error "instantiated from here" "" { target *-*-* } 41 }
// { dg-error "instantiated from here" "" { target *-*-* } 43 }
// { dg-error "invalid use of incomplete type" "" { target *-*-* } 418 }
// { dg-error "declaration of" "" { target *-*-* } 384 }
// { dg-error "invalid use of incomplete type" "" { target *-*-* } 414 }
// { dg-error "declaration of" "" { target *-*-* } 380 }
// { dg-excess-errors "At global scope" }
// { dg-excess-errors "In instantiation of" }

View file

@ -134,7 +134,7 @@ namespace __gnu_test
func_callback(const func_callback&);
public:
func_callback(): _M_size(0) { };
func_callback(): _M_size(0) { }
int
size() const { return _M_size; }